On Desktops, there's this fantastic tool Snip It where you can select stuff and past it staight into the body of an email, so it's pasted and not attached for someone to have to open.

With the Tab S4, I don't see how to do that. Of course we have the S Pen and can select an area, etc but I don't see a way to copy/paste it into the body of an email, whether it be a new email or a reply.
 
Are you talking about text or pictures? Text is simple. Highlight it, copy, long-press in the email and you should get a Paste toast when you let up - tap that and it's pasted.

Pictures? Open a picture in a picture editor, select the portion you want, copy it, then do the same. You can't "snip" a portion of the screen. (You can snip a portion of the screen, then paste it into a picture editor, then highlight it and copy it. An S-Pen selection isn't the same format as a picture.)
 
I believe inline insertion of an image is a function of the application that you are inserting the image into, not the image itself. I don't know of any Android email app that allows inline insertion.
